Comprehending Insolvency: A Comprehensive Definition


Insolvency is actually a essential fiscal affliction where by someone, small business, or Business is struggling to fork out its debts as they become owing. It is crucial to understand that insolvency is different from simply staying small on funds or getting lousy liquidity — it refers especially to The shortcoming to satisfy economical obligations on time or when demanded by creditors.


There are two Principal strategies insolvency can existing itself: via dollars stream insolvency, where a debtor has belongings but lacks liquid funds to pay debts, and balance sheet insolvency, the place liabilities exceed assets, indicating the overall price of what's owed is larger than exactly what is owned.


Being familiar with insolvency is essential for business people, buyers, creditors, and men and women alike, as it marks a pivotal fiscal point out That always results in lawful proceedings for example personal bankruptcy, administration, or liquidation.

Types of Insolvency: Hard cash Circulation vs Equilibrium Sheet


Insolvency will not be a just one-dimension-matches-all concept. There's two principal categories:


Dollars Flow Insolvency


This kind of insolvency comes about when a business or specific cannot pay out debts because they appear thanks, even when they've got property exceeding liabilities. It’s a liquidity challenge where dollars isn't offered when wanted. As an example, a business may personal useful tools or home but haven't any All set income to protect payroll or supplier invoices.


Hard cash stream insolvency may be momentary and fixable through improved management or shorter-expression funding.


Stability Sheet Insolvency


Equilibrium sheet insolvency occurs when overall liabilities exceed complete property, meaning the entity’s Internet worth is adverse. Even though hard cash movement is good at the moment, the overall economic health and fitness is weak since liabilities outweigh methods.


This sort often alerts much more significant money hassle and could involve restructuring, asset sales, or liquidation.





Legal Implications and Insolvency Proceedings


When insolvency is determined, lawful frameworks normally appear into result to guard creditors and supply a fair resolution system. Insolvency legislation range by jurisdiction but normally contain a number of key features:


1. Official Insolvency Treatments


Based on the problem, a courtroom or regulatory system may possibly appoint insolvency practitioners to manage the method. Popular formal insolvency processes include things like:



  • Administration: An appointed administrator requires control of the corporate to test to restructure and rescue it.

  • Liquidation: Belongings are bought off to repay creditors, generally ending with firm dissolution.

  • Company Voluntary Preparations (CVAs): Negotiated agreements among a business and its creditors to pay debts with time even though continuing operations.

  • Bankruptcy: Lawful course of action principally for individuals, letting discharge of debts underneath court supervision.


two. Creditors’ Rights and Protections


Insolvency laws intention to stability pursuits by making certain creditors are treated quite, generally through a structured statements procedure and prioritization of personal debt repayments.


3. Outcomes for Administrators and Management


Directors of insolvent organizations may experience legal scrutiny if mismanagement or wrongful buying and selling is suspected. Insolvency practitioners also look into prior perform to protect stakeholder interests.
